Fil-Chi community mobilizes relief efforts in Cebu

The Federation of Filipino-Chinese Chambers of Commerce and Industry, Inc. (FFCCCII) launched a relief operation to aid families affected by Typhoon Tino in Cebu.

Under the leadership of FFCCCII president Victor Lim and in collaboration with the Cebu Mandaue Filipino-Chinese Chamber of Commerce and Industry, along with the Filipino at Tsino Magkaibigan Foundation, the initiative aims to support those in need.

Typhoon Tino has caused devastating impacts, resulting in over 100 fatalities and numerous injuries, which led to a declaration of a state of calamity in the region.

On Nov. 22, CFCCC president Huang Jia Shun, along with other leaders from the Filipino-Chinese community and local government officials, distributed 2,700 bags of rice (5 kilograms each) and 941 containers of drinking water (5 gallons each) to residents in various Barangays of Mandaue.

The humanitarian effort highlights the community’s commitment to assisting those in distress during this challenging time.
